Mardi Gras : This week on Sharp and Hot Emily reads from what she calls “My father’s bible,” which we find out is Paul Perdone’s Louisiana Cooking. After laughing at the cover of the cook book for a moment, Emily dives in to her streamlined recipe for jambalaya and how to make it vegetarian. She and Anne discuss king cakes, oysters, and some of the more ridiculous things you can find in New Orleans, including alcoholic slushy stands.
